Additional file 2 of Marker-Assisted Introgression of the Salinity Tolerance Locus Saltol in Temperate Japonica Rice

Abstract

Additional file 2. Table S1. Saltol-linked SSR markers, used for foreground selection on F1 and BC1F1 generations and their physical position on chromosome 1; primer nucleotide sequences, and physical locations within the Saltol QTL are provided.

NEURICE project (New commercial European RICE (Oryza sativa) harbouring salt tolerance alleles to protect the rice sector against climate change and apple snail (Pomacea insularum) invasion
